Neighborhood Overview

East High School is situated in the eastern portion of Aurora, a historic and vibrant city located roughly 40 miles west of downtown Chicago. The facility is easily accessed from major regional routes, including I-88 and Illinois Route 31, which connect the suburb to the broader Chicagoland area. Travelers arriving by air will typically utilize Chicago O'Hare International Airport or Midway International Airport, both of which are approximately 45 to 60 minutes away depending on traffic conditions. Parking at the venue is centralized within the campus grounds, with dedicated lots providing ample space for both standard vehicles and team buses.

Navigating the immediate area is straightforward, though local traffic can increase during morning and afternoon school hours. The surrounding residential streets are well-maintained, and main thoroughfares offer quick access to commercial zones filled with amenities. Rideshare services like Uber and Lyft are readily available throughout Aurora, making it convenient to travel between the high school and local hotels or restaurants. For those planning to use public transit, the Metra BNSF line provides a reliable connection to Chicago, with stations located in downtown Aurora that are a short drive from the school. Visitors should aim to arrive at the venue at least 30 minutes before their scheduled event to account for parking and walking to the specific fields or gymnasiums.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Aurora is cold and often snowy, requiring heavy coats, hats, and gloves for any outdoor movement. Most athletic events are held indoors during this season, providing a comfortable environment away from the elements. Be sure to allow extra travel time for potential snow or icy road conditions.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ring is beautiful but brings significant rainfall and variable temperatures, so packing a waterproof jacket is mandatory. Layers are highly recommended as mornings can be chilly while afternoons warm up significantly. Outdoor fields may be soft, so plan your footwear accordingly if you are walking between playing areas.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er is hot and humid, with temperatures frequently reaching into the 80s and 90s. Staying hydrated is the most important factor for players and spectators alike during these long, sunny days. Seek shade whenever possible and wear breathable clothing to remain comfortable while watching the events.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is arguably the most pleasant time to visit, featuring crisp air and comfortable daytime temperatures. It is perfect for outdoor events, though evenings can turn cool quickly, so bring a sweater or light jacket. The changing foliage around the campus also makes for a lovely backdrop.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ur throughout the year, often arriving in short, intense bursts during the warmer months. Snow is common from December through March and can impact travel logistics significantly. Always check local forecasts the night before your event to prepare for any necessary adjustments to your schedule.
